Organizational amnesty. Amnesty International (AI) is one of the most prominent advocacy agencies in the world. The agency is an international non-governmental organization headquartered in the United Kingdom (Amnesty International, n.d.). AI focuses on protecting human rights, whose scope of violations constantly changes every day (Amnesty International, n.d.).

Amnesty International is an international nongovernmental organization with a focus on human rights. Founded in London in 1961, Amnesty is the largest and longest serving human rights organization in the world. They won the Nobel Peace Prize in 1977 for their "campaign against torture " and the United Nations Prize in the field of Human Rights ...

Amnesty International recorded that 1,477 death sentences were imposed in 54 countries, down 36% from at least 2,307 in 2019. At the end of 2020, at least 28,567 people were known to be under sentence of death.
